The truth is, if you’re buying from one of the major PC manufacturers, you’ll have a lot of crap pre-installed on your computer. At the very least they’re annoying and unnecessary. At the most it can severely cripple performance and make it hard to run your computer at the full speed at which it’s intended.
I ran across this site and though I haven’t tested it (I tend to just format my drive whenever I get a new computer and install my own stuff and drivers), PCDecrapifier seems to be exactly what most new computer users should be using. It takes out the horrid WildTangent Games, pesky Symantec subscriptions, and so forth.
